Pure Encapsulations Gluten/Dairy Digest
Supports Gluten and Dairy Digestion
Gluten/Dairy Digest contains a blend of digestive enzymes targeting gluten and dairy digestion. Gluten/Dairy Digest includes a blend of proteases specially formulated with the scientifically researched prolyl-endopeptidase enzyme targeting gluten breakdown.

More Info.
In a randomized, double-blind, placebo-controlled trial, individuals consuming prolyl-endopeptidase enzyme and gluten showed lower αgliadin (a main component of gluten) concentration in the stomach and duodenum. In another randomized, placebo-controlled, crossover study, 18 gluten-sensitive subjects consumed a mixed meal containing 0.5 g of gluten. Tolerase® G (83,300 PPI) significantly degraded gluten concentrations in both the stomach and duodenum. In the stomach, median gluten levels were reduced from 176.9 mcg (range of 73.5-357.8 mcg) to 25.4 mcg (16.4-43.7 mcg, p=0.001). In the duodenum, median gluten levels were reduced from 14.1 mcg (range of 8.3-124.7) to 7.4 mcg (3.8-12 mcg, p=0.015).
The enzyme specifically degrades the immunogenic parts of the gluten protein. Research reveals that gluten-sensitive T-cells no longer react after gluten has been degraded with the enzyme. Additionally, this formula provides a unique mixture of protease enzymes and lactase to assist in the digestion of multiple constituents of milk and dairy products. Protease enzymes targeting casein and beta-lactoglobulin proteins support dairy protein digestion. Casein is the predominant protein in milk and cheese. Beta-lactoglobulin occurs primarily in the whey fraction of milk. It is an acid-stable protein and therefore may not be broken down by pepsin and pancreatin. Lactase breaks down the milk sugar lactose, helping to relieve occasional bloating or gas that some people can experience from dairy consumption.
Enzymes are derived from microbial fermentation.
